1. Increased Development Time and Costs
Implementing RTL support isn’t a simple switch you can flip. It requires careful planning, meticulous coding, and extensive testing. Developers need to ensure that every element, from text alignment to image placement, is correctly mirrored and functional. This often involves creating separate stylesheets or using complex conditional logic, adding layers of complexity to the codebase.
The debugging process can also be more time-consuming. Identifying and fixing RTL-related bugs often requires a deeper understanding of the underlying layout engine and how it handles bidirectional text. This can be especially challenging for developers who are not familiar with RTL languages or cultures. It’s like trying to decipher a foreign language without a translator — frustrating and inefficient.
All of this adds up to increased development time and, consequently, higher costs. Businesses need to factor in these additional expenses when budgeting for RTL support. It’s not just a matter of translating the text; it’s about rebuilding the entire user experience. Neglecting this aspect can lead to a poorly implemented RTL interface that frustrates users and damages the brand’s reputation. Imagine launching a product in a new market only to find out that your website is unusable!
Moreover, maintaining RTL support over time requires ongoing investment. As new features are added or the design is updated, developers must ensure that these changes are properly implemented in RTL. This continuous effort adds to the long-term maintenance costs. It’s like constantly renovating your house there’s always something new to fix or improve, which means more time and money spent.
2. Design Challenges and Aesthetic Considerations
Adapting a design originally conceived for LTR to RTL can present significant design challenges. Elements that look perfectly balanced in LTR might appear awkward or asymmetrical when mirrored. Designers need to carefully consider the visual flow and balance of the page to ensure that the RTL version is aesthetically pleasing and user-friendly.
For instance, images and icons that imply direction (e.g., arrows pointing to the right) need to be flipped to point to the left. Failure to do so can lead to confusion and misinterpretation. It’s like driving on the wrong side of the road you might get to your destination, but the journey will be fraught with peril. The devil is truly in the details.
Text alignment also plays a crucial role in the overall aesthetic. While right-aligning text is common in RTL languages, designers need to be mindful of how it affects readability and visual appeal. Long blocks of right-aligned text can be harder to scan than left-aligned text, especially for users who are accustomed to LTR layouts. Finding the right balance between cultural appropriateness and usability is key.
Furthermore, adapting the overall visual hierarchy to RTL requires a fresh perspective. Elements that are typically placed on the left in LTR, such as navigation menus or sidebars, need to be moved to the right. This can significantly alter the look and feel of the interface, potentially requiring a complete redesign. 3. Technical Hurdles and Browser Compatibility Issues
Despite advancements in web technologies, consistent RTL support across different browsers and devices remains a challenge. Some browsers may not fully support RTL layouts, leading to rendering issues and inconsistent user experiences. This fragmentation forces developers to spend extra time testing and debugging, ensuring that the website or application looks and functions correctly on all platforms.
Older browsers, in particular, often lack proper RTL support. This means that users with outdated browsers may encounter broken layouts, misaligned text, or other visual glitches. Developers may need to implement workarounds or use polyfills to ensure that the RTL version is accessible to all users. It’s like trying to run a modern video game on an old computer it might technically work, but the performance will be subpar.
Even with modern browsers, subtle differences in rendering can still occur. Font rendering, in particular, can vary significantly across different platforms, affecting the readability and visual appeal of the text. Developers need to carefully choose fonts that are well-suited for RTL languages and test them thoroughly on different browsers and devices.
Furthermore, integrating third-party libraries and frameworks into an RTL environment can be tricky. Many libraries are designed with LTR in mind and may not be fully compatible with RTL layouts. Developers may need to modify these libraries or find alternative solutions that offer better RTL support. 5. User Experience Challenges and Accessibility Considerations
If not implemented carefully, RTL layouts can present user experience challenges. Users who are accustomed to LTR interfaces may find it difficult to navigate and interact with RTL layouts, especially if the design is not intuitive or consistent. It’s like learning to drive on the opposite side of the road it takes time and practice to get used to it.
Accessibility is another important consideration. RTL layouts need to be designed to be accessible to users with disabilities, such as visual impairments or motor impairments. This includes ensuring that the text is readable, the controls are easy to use, and the website is compatible with assistive technologies like screen readers. It’s like building a ramp next to a staircase it makes the building accessible to everyone, regardless of their abilities.
Keyboard navigation is particularly important for users with motor impairments. Developers need to ensure that the keyboard focus order is logical and intuitive in RTL layouts. This means that users should be able to navigate through the website using the tab key in a way that makes sense in the RTL context. It’s like creating a clear and well-marked path through a forest it allows everyone to navigate the forest safely and efficiently.
Furthermore, providing clear visual cues and instructions can help users understand how to interact with the RTL interface. This can include using icons, tooltips, or labels to guide users through the different features and functions.
